ubuntu 删除路由_如何在Ubuntu Linux中删除路由?
时间: 2024-05-13 17:18:43 浏览: 282
在Ubuntu Linux中,可以使用`route`命令来删除路由。以下是删除路由的步骤:
1. 打开终端。
2. 使用以下命令查看当前路由表:`route -n`
3. 找到要删除的路由的目标网络地址和子网掩码。
4. 使用以下命令删除路由:`sudo route del -net 目标网络地址 netmask 子网掩码`
例如,如果要删除目标网络地址为192.168.1.0,子网掩码为255.255.255.0的路由,可以使用以下命令:
```
sudo route del -net 192.168.1.0 netmask 255.255.255.0
```
注意:使用`sudo`命令以管理员权限运行删除路由命令。
相关问题
ubuntu 增加路由
要在Ubuntu中添加新路由,您可以使用ip命令。首先,您可以使用以下命令显示当前的路由表和信息:
```
ip route show
```
这将显示当前的路由表。接下来,您可以使用以下命令添加新路由:
```
sudo ip route add <目标网络> via <网关> dev <接口>
```
其中,<目标网络>是您要访问的目标网络的IP地址或CIDR块,<网关>是您要使用的网关的IP地址,<接口>是您要从中访问目标网络的网络接口。
例如,如果您要添加一个路由以访问IP地址为192.168.1.0/24的目标网络,网关为192.168.0.1,接口为eth0,您可以使用以下命令:
```
sudo ip route add 192.168.1.0/24 via 192.168.0.1 dev eth0
```
请确保使用sudo命令以管理员权限运行这些命令。这样,您就可以在Ubuntu中成功添加新的路由了。\[2\]
#### 引用[.reference_title]
- *1* *2* *3* [ubuntu添加路由_如何在Ubuntu,Linux中添加新路由?](https://blog.csdn.net/cunjiu9486/article/details/109072169)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^control,239^v3^insert_chatgpt"}} ] [.reference_item]
[ .reference_list ]
Ubuntu添加路由
在Ubuntu系统中添加静态路由通常是为了设置网络连接到非默认网段,比如访问私有网络或互联网。以下是向Linux内核添加静态路由的基本步骤:
1. 打开终端:通过快捷键`Ctrl+Alt+T`或者在应用程序菜单搜索“终端”。
2. 使用文本编辑器打开路由器配置文件:`sudo nano /etc/network/interfaces` 或者 `sudo nano /etc/netplan/00-cloud-init.yaml`(如果使用的是Netplan配置)。
3. 添加新的路由条目:在文件底部添加类似下面的行,其中`gw`是网关地址,`net`是你想添加路由的目的网络,`mask`是子网掩码:
```bash
route add -net <destination_network> netmask <subnet_mask> gw <gateway_address>
```
例如:
```bash
route add -net 192.168.2.0/24 netmask 255.255.255.0 gw 192.168.1.1
```
这里假设你想从192.168.1.0/24网络访问192.168.2.0/24网络,并将网关设置为192.168.1.1。
4. 保存并退出:按`Ctrl+X`,然后选择`Y`保存更改,最后输入`Enter`确认。
5. 应用配置:如果是`interfaces`文件,重启网络服务应用更改:
```bash
sudo ifdown eth0 && sudo ifup eth0
```
如果是`netplan`配置,可以使用`sudo netplan apply`。